Job description

We are seeking a dynamic, mission-driven leader to join Ready on our P3 team to manage our customer implementations and success.This individual will serve as a key partner to government stakeholders, ensuring complex, multi-stakeholder projects are delivered seamlessly while unlocking long-term partnerships across verticals like broadband, transportation, energy, and water infrastructure. The ideal candidate brings a mix of public sector savvy, technical fluency, and a growth mindset—leveraging AI tools to scale impact, track progress, and turn customers into champions.

About Your Role At Ready ️

  • Lead a customer implementation and success team, working with customers to ensure that projects are executed on time, within scope, and to high quality standards.
  • Guide state and local partners through program implementation—turning mandates into milestones and challenges into opportunities.
  • Represent the customer needs to cross-functional contributors within Ready including software engineers, designers, product managers, and policy experts.
  • Use AI-driven tooling to manage documentation, track project health, and create transparency across stakeholders.
  • Build trusted relationships with key decision-makers, enabling Ready to expand horizontally across state programs beyond broadband.
  • Collaborate with sales, product, engineering, and marketing teams to ensure our platform evolves with real-world needs and policy shifts.
  • Stay up-to-date on relevant federal and state policy developments; distill insights to drive proactive engagement.
  • Identify opportunities for cross-agency growth in areas like water, energy, transportation, and public safety.
  • Provide mentorship and coaching to team members and support the efficient flow of information and expertise throughout the organization.
  • Represent Ready at key convenings, public sector forums, and strategic meetings.

A Bit About You

  • Deep familiarity with how federal funding flows through state and local government—experience in broadband, infrastructure, or related programs is a plus.
  • Experience implementing technical solutions with or within government (e.g., GovTech, civic tech, federal grant programs).
  • Ability to quickly learn federal policy frameworks and advise internal teams and clients accordingly.
  • Technically fluent—you’re comfortable adopting new tools quickly (e.g., Slack, Linear, Notion, AI tools like Claude or ChatGPT) and using them to drive efficiency, collaboration, and insight.
  • Proven track record managing or mentoring client-facing teams in fast-paced or high-growth environments.
  • Exceptional communication, relationship-building, and stakeholder management skills—especially in politically complex environments.
  • Strong critical thinking and analytical skills, with the ability to anticipate both immediate needs and longer-term opportunities.
  • Self-starter who thrives on ownership and autonomy, but collaborates well across technical and non-technical teams.
  • Bachelor’s degree in public policy, business, technology, communications, or a related field. A master's degree is a big plus.
  • Nice to have: Project management experience and/or certifications (e.g., PMP, Agile, Scrum).
